LEDinside: LED Lighting-Use Market Contracted Up to 16% in Fourth Quarter

The lighting-use LED market contracted 5-16% in the fourth quarter, while backlighting-use LED products fell 4-13% according to a new report from LEDinside, a division of the Taiwan-based market intelligence firm TrendForce. The average price of lighting-use LED products is falling with the arrival of the non-peak season and as competition intensifies among manufacturers, said Jack Kuo, an assistant research manager at LEDinside. “Orders are falling and profits are being squeezed,” he said. “For manufacturers to increase their market share, they need to introduce more new products.”

LEDinside: Q3 LED Lighting Demand Flat, Market Sees Intense Price Competition

In the third quarter, when LED market activity typically slows, LED backlighting prices declined an average of 3-8% as demand fell. Meanwhile, LED demand for lighting applications remained flat, but price competition in the overall LED market, remained fierce, as prices fell 6-12%, according to LEDinside, a subsidiary of the Taiwan-based market intelligence firmTrendForce.
